Ubuntu 16.04 + Nvidia Driver = tela em branco

31

ATUALIZAÇÃO ORIGINAL DA PERGUNTA 1:

Incluindo captura de tela de Drivers adicionais. Eu tentei instalar ambos os 361.42 e 340.96 e ambas as vezes, eu recebo uma tela em branco após o reinício.

PERGUNTAORIGINAL:

QuandoeuinstaloodrivernvidiaparaoUbuntue,emseguida,reinicio,receboumatelaembranco.Eunãotentei2dosdriversnvidiaeemambasasvezeseureceboumatelaembranco.

Comoinstaloosdriversnvidiaenãoobtenhoumatelaembranco?

FizumapesquisanoGoogleeparecequeeusouoprimeiroaencontraresteproblemadesde16.04foilançado:

link

    
por oshirowanen 22.04.2016 / 09:37

7 respostas

23

Onde / quando você recebe a tela em branco? É quando o menu do grub deve aparecer na inicialização, ou quando a tela de login do Ubuntu Unity deve aparecer? Se for o último, tente o seguinte:

  1. Adicione nomodeset em sua entrada do Ubuntu grub. Realce a entrada que você usa para inicializar, pressione e, em seguida, adicione substituir

    ... ro quiet splash ...

    com

    ... ro nomodeset quiet splash ...

Se você inicializar corretamente na tela de login, pressione Ctrl + Alt + F2 , faça o login e execute sudo prime-select intel . Em seguida, reinicie e veja se isso corrige isso.

Além disso, como você está instalando os drivers da NVidia? DOuble-check em nvidia.com se você estiver usando os corretos.

    
por SteveFromAccounting 22.04.2016 / 19:17
6

Aqui está minha solução. Eu tive que puxar respostas de vários locais.

Minha placa gráfica é a NVidia GeForce GTX 950 .

A primeira coisa que fiz foi baixar o mais recente driver NVidia estável da nvidia.com (para mim, era 361.42). Eu tinha certeza de selecionar o último driver estável e certificado. É um arquivo ".run", a propósito. Pesquise como instalar arquivos .run se você não estiver familiarizado com isso.

Eu então coloquei os drivers do Nouveau na lista negra de acordo com este post (meus passos estão abaixo e são um pouco diferentes deste post):

Instale o driver da Nvidia em vez nouveau

Eu fiz todos do meu trabalho através do terminal virtual acessado por Ctrl + Alt + F1 na tela de login:

1) Bloqueie os módulos. Abra o arquivo blacklist.conf.

sudo vi /etc/modprobe.d/blacklist.conf

adicione os seguintes módulos ao final do arquivo:

blacklist vga16fb
blacklist nouveau
blacklist rivafb
blacklist nvidiafb
blacklist rivatv

Salve o arquivo e saia.

2) Remova todos os pacotes nvidia * (note que isso não fez nada para mim, mas é recomendado. Não há nenhum dano ao executá-lo)

sudo apt-get remove --purge nvidia*

3) Atualize o disco initramfs. O meu foi configurado para carregar os drivers nouveau. Demora vários segundos. Não reinicie ou desligue!

sudo update-initramfs -u

4) Reinicie

5) Pare o gerenciador de exibição e instale.

Na tela de login, pressione Ctrl + Alt + F1 novamente para entrar no terminal virtual. Quando estiver no modo de texto, pare o gerenciador de exibição:

sudo service lightdm stop

6) Em seguida, execute o arquivo de instalação (o arquivo .run que você baixou). A instalação está bem documentada e contém muitas mensagens úteis ao longo do caminho (imagine isso!). Eu recebi o erro sobre o script de pré-instalação falhando. Eu continuei assim mesmo. Eu fui perguntado "Você gostaria de executar o utilitário nvidia-xconfig para atualizar automaticamente seu arquivo de configuração X para que o driver NVIDIA X será usado quando você reiniciar o X? Qualquer arquivo de configuração X pré-existente será feito o backup" eu respondi " Sim "e continuou. Eu tenho um sistema de 64 bits e tenho erros de 32 bits. Eu não me preocupei com isso e continuei. Os de 64 bits bem instalados. Cheguei ao final da instalação!

7) Cruze os dedos, reinicie e faça o login. Meu sistema FINALMENTE surgiu. Espero que a sua também faça isso!

    
por DerWanderer 26.04.2016 / 19:57
2

Tente adicionar nvidia ppa ppa: graphics-drivers / ppa e instale o último 364.15.

Isso funciona para mim com o otimus de 860m.

Isso funciona somente se você tiver a Inicialização segura desativada.

    
por Eduardo Moñino Esteban 22.04.2016 / 16:58
2

Talvez você tenha que colocar na lista negra os drivers nvidia na inicialização. Isso às vezes é necessário para cartões gráficos híbridos.

  • Edite o arquivo: /etc/modprobe.d/bumblebee.conf e adicione:

    blacklist nvidia-XXX
    blacklist nvidia-XXX-updates
    blacklist nvidia-experimental-XXX
    

    substitua o XXX pela versão do driver gráfico. Por exemplo 346

  • reinicie o seu computador.

por JOnathanJOnes 24.04.2016 / 00:13
1

Eu resolvi essa questão de uma maneira diferente. Eu instalei 16.04 em um computador muito antigo. Eu instalei o driver legado da Nvidia e obtive a tela em branco.

Eu instalei o Lubuntu para usar a área de trabalho do LXDE. Isso está funcionando muito bem para mim.

sudo apt-get install lubuntu-desktop
    
por Mattmon 17.06.2016 / 18:14
0

Certifique-se de ter o safeboot desativado, por acaso o meu foi ativado e ignorei o aviso quando atualizei para o 16.04. Se você tiver secureboot, ele ficará preso no gdm ou em uma tela preta.

    
por user533456 22.04.2016 / 14:32
-2

Tente adicionar as seguintes opções ao seu arquivo de configuração grub / etc / default / grub. Você precisará atualizar o grub depois.

GRUB_GFXMODE=1280x1024x32,auto
GRUB_GFXPAYLOAD_LINUX=keep
    
por Ash 23.04.2016 / 03:01